Silent Night is a Temptation

You would think that with the holiday season coming to a close I would be sick of Christmas music but quite the contrary. I dug out my old favorites and researched some new ones on i-tunes. Five days left until Christmas and that means there are four more days of Christmas music to play in my store. The sappier the better. Here is my list of top 10 favorites, old and new. 1."Silent Night" by the Temptations (1980)-the long version, is still my number one favorite. This soulful melody keeps me harmonizing and happy year after year. I hope I don't scare away any shoppers.

The rest are as follows: 2. "I'll Be Home for Christmas" by Jordin Sparks or Sara Evans; 3. "Have Yourself a Merry Little Christmas" by Julianne Hough or Martina McBride; and I would be remiss if I did not mention my two favorite classics from A Charlie Brown Christmas by Vincent Guaraldi Trio, 4. "Linus and Lucy" and 5. "Christmas is Here". Last year I became quite fond of the Trans-Siberian Orchestra (T.S.O.) with three songs on my list: 6. "Christmas, Sarajevo 12/24", 7. "A Mad Russian's Christmas", and 8. "Joy of Man's Desire/Angels We Have heard on High". Of course, I have to throw in a Chipmunk song and that would be 9. "The Christmas Song". I especially like to play this song for one of my studio mates who writhes in pain every time. It's really fun to watch...hehehe. And last but not least, 10."Auld Lang Syne" by just about anyone. Dan Fogelberg is one of my old favorites and John Fahey plays a nice mellow guitar version.

Under One's WINGS

Friday night I sold my jewelry at a fundraiser for WINGS at St. Charles Church and School in San Carlos. I had never heard of WINGS and when I "googled" WINGS I found a few entries but nothing local. WINGS stands for Women In God's Spirit. A nice lady there explained that it was a "club" for women to get together and talk about God and to strengthen their relationships with each other and God. The Fundraiser was quaint and very fun. There were a lot of gift baskets raffled and half of the craft vendors won a basket including me! Of course, I picked the one with the most chocolate and I did share it with my fellow vendors. Twelve tickets well worth the prize! I found the people to be very friendly and I hope that there will be more of a presence for this local branch of WINGS. We need more nice people in the world.
